Last Tuesday we had our regular monthly OSPS meeting.
Our guest was Albert Sieg. Al has been a stereo photographer
for over 40 years and he is currently the world's leading stereo
exhibitor with over 1800 stereo slides accepted for exhibition.
He is currently the President of PSA. In addition to his glorious
stereo career, Al worked for Eastman Kodak where he held
the post of Vice President in the USA and President of Eastman
Kodak Japan.
Al presented 7 short sequences, from exotic places all over
the world, from Antarctica to wild life in Africa. The great stereo
photography was supplement by very interesting narration and
a question and answer period. We saw pictures taken with
cameras ranging from a Stereo Realist, to a twin SLR rig with
800mm lenses in separate tripods, aligned with laser beams.
We heard how Al would rather carry 60 pounds of camera
equipment than food to eat, during some of his trips.
The second part of our meeting was a regular stereo slide
competition "Nature - no hand of man". Al Sieg was one
of the three judges and commented on all entries. A great
educational experience!
Even though some of our regular members were not able to
attend due to sickness, we still had over 30 people and added
a new member to our group. We also had a visitor from
Brazil. He said that this was his second stereo meeting.
The previous one was 10 years ago in Paris France.
Coming up: April 21 is the judging of the 1st OSPS Stereo
Exhibition and May 1 we will show the accepted entries in
our regular monthly meeting.
